RANGAMATI, March 19, 2026 (BSS)- Chattogram Hill Tracts (CHT) Affairs Minister Advocate Dipen Dewan, MP, today said that wealthy and conscious people of the society should come forward to support the underprivileged instead of relying solely on the government.
"It is possible to build a humane and welfare-oriented society only through the collective efforts of people from all walks of life," he said.
The minister said this while addressing an Eid gift distribution and Mehndi festival, organised by the Organisation for Unity Trust and Help (Youth) at the Rangamati District Children's Academy auditorium.
"Politics should be practiced with the mindset of serving the people," he said, adding that public welfare should be given the highest priority.
Dipen Dewan said the organisation has been working for the welfare of the underprivileged children of the society for a long time, which deserves praise.
He assured that necessary support will be provided to further expand the activities of this organisation in the future.
Rangamati Sadar Zone Commander Lieutenant Colonel Ekramul Rahat, District BNP leader Shashat Chakma Rinku, Rangamati Press Club President Anwar Al Haque, District Red Crescent Society General Secretary Md. Saiful Islam Shakil and District Council Member Md. Habib Azam, among others, addressed it as special guests.
General Secretary of the organisation Rupam Tanchangya presided over the event while its Director Iqbal Hossain moderated it.
